ZubaZ
Reply #7 Wednesday, April 25, 2007 9:40 AM
Bootskins are not compatible with all BIOS, so there is a chance it might not work.
If it does not work, all you have to do is boot into safe mode, and set the default bootskin back, then reboot normally and uninstall.
